Toshio Kuratomi eeebd51f21 Rename the type filter to type_debug
Because we add the names of all filters to the callable whitelist used
by safe_eval, adding a filter named type makes it so code calling "type()"
gets eval'd.  We can't think of a way to exploit this but it's
sufficiently sketchy that we're renaming it in case someone smarter than
us can think of a problem.

Jamie Lennox 27d218f85d Don't use rsync-path in synchronize with docker
When you become: with synchronize and docker it sets the rsync-path to
"sudo rsync" to launch rsync on the server as root. Unfortunately due to
docker exec doing stricter argument parsing than ssh this fails to
launch rsync on the server and the sync fails.

For docker though we don't need to launch rsync with sudo we can simply
docker exec -u <user> and rsync as normal to get around the problem.

Closes #20117

Toshio Kuratomi 1786c81a65 Previous fix to this failed to account for open_url returning a filehandle (#20097)
* Previous fix to this failed to account for open_url returning a filehandle

Fixes the bugs introduced by c6fb355

* read() from HTTPError for python-3.6+

HTTPError is funny.  It contains a filehandle to read the response from
and also makes it available via a read() method.  On earlier versions of
python (2 and 3) the read() method was enough to make it work with
json.load().  The newer version of json.load() needs a more complete
file interface than this and has stopped working.  Read the bytes,
transform to str and pass it in manually to fix it.
